Stress - ANSWER a negative emotional experience associated
with biological changes that trigger the body to make
adaptations
Job Stress - ANSWER the harmful physical and emotional
responses that occur when the requirements of the job do not
match the capabilities, resources, or needs of the workers
Time Management - ANSWER a deliberative process of
identifying and focusing on the activities needed to accomplish
tasks and goals in the time available
Time Management Strategies and Techniques - ANSWER
Cognitive Stacking, Prioritization, Routinization, Time Audit
Cognitive Stacking - ANSWER a time-saving strategy used to
plan the day before starting work

ex. Mental list, E-List
Prioritization - ANSWER prioritizing based on importance
ex. CURE, ABCs, Maslow's Hierarchy
Routinization - ANSWER sequence activities and establish a
time-frame expectation for routine task
Time Audit - ANSWER tracking time for 24 hours of 1-2 seeks;
identify small time gaps where small tasks may be completed
Methods for Coping and Adaptation in Nursing - ANSWER
mindful mediation, biofeedback, taking personal time each day,
drinking fluids, setting boundaries, getting enough sleep,
exercising, relaxing, eating healthy, leaning on support systems,
journaling
Role Management - ANSWER the activities necessary for
leaders to successfully develop and maintain role definitions
over time, based on standardized expectations within an
organization

Five Rights of Delegation - ANSWER 1. Right Task
2. Right Conditions/Circumstances
3. Right Individual
4. Right Instructions
5. Right Supervision and Assessment
Autonomy - ANSWER an individual's right for self-governance,
free from controlling interference by others
Beneficence - ANSWER doing good by helping others with
compassionate care
Nonmaleficence - ANSWER avoid causing harm on others
Justice - ANSWER provision of fair and equal treatment,
consistent with equal distribution of benefits and burden
Group - ANSWER any collection of interconnected individuals
working together for some purpose

Committee - ANSWER a relatively stable and formally composed
group; a specific type of group in that they are stable, meet
periodically, and have an identified purpose that is part of the
organizational structure
Team - ANSWER made up of persons working on individual
tasks that impact the overall objectives of the group
Team Building - ANSWER the process of deliberately creating
and unifying a group into a functioning team
Advantages to Groups - ANSWER synergy, positive individual
impacts, motivation, diverse thinking, linkage to larger
organization
Disadvantages to Groups - ANSWER negativity, passivity,
individual focus/domination, groupthink, vocal minority, ethical
dark side, disruptive conflicts
